National Route 6 (officially, Ruta Nacional Número 6 "Dr. Juan León Mallorquín", better known as Ruta Sexta) is one of the national highways of Paraguay. With a length of 252 km[1] it mainly connects the second and third most populated cities in Paraguay, Ciudad del Este and Encarnación respectively. It crosses the departments of Alto Parana and Itapua.[2]
Distances and important cities
The following table shows the distances traversed by National Route 6 in each different department, and important cities that it passes by (or near).
| Km | City | Department | Junctions |
|---|---|---|---|
| 0 | Encarnación | Itapua | Route 1 |
| 6 | Capitán Miranda | Itapua | |
| 21 | Trinidad | Itapua | |
| 35 | Hohenau | Itapua | |
| 38 | Obligado | Itapua | |
| 48 | Bella Vista | Itapua | |
| 71 | Pirapó | Itapua | |
| 87 | Capitán Meza | Itapua | |
| 93 | Edelira | Itapua | |
| 119 | Tomás Romero Pereira | Itapua | |
| 206 | Santa Rita | Alto Parana | |
| 247 | Minga Guazú | Alto Parana | Route 7 |
